UC's Puente Project Faces Discrimination Complaint Over Latino Focus

1/19/2026

50 6

1 of 1

Story summary
  • The University of California faces a civil rights complaint alleging the Puente Project discriminates against non-Latino students.
  • The Equal Protection Project says the program is funded with $13 million in state money and primarily serves Latino students, violating the Civil Rights Act of 1964.
  • They argue the program's structure sends exclusionary signals that deter non-Latino applicants.
  • The University defended the program's legality, stating it complies with anti-discrimination laws.
